Great Stripe-faced Bat vs Greater Naked Bat
Vampyrodes major compared with Cheiromeles torquatus
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Great Stripe-faced Bat | Greater Naked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mammifères) | Mammalia (mammifères) |
| Order same | Chiroptera (Bats)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Molossidae |
| Genus | Vampyrodes | Cheiromeles |
| Species | Vampyrodes major | Cheiromeles torquatus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Great Stripe-faced Bat and Greater Naked Bat share a common ancestor at the Order level: Chiroptera. (Bats)
